### Job Description
* Practice in accordance with Pyles & Associates’ policies and procedures. * Oversee clinical programs, and monitor staff under the supervision of the * Clinical Director and/or BCBA Supervisor * Supervise assigned staff * Master’s Level Program Manager must demonstrate the ability to use relevant behavioral data to monitor client performance and make observations * Conduct assessments, develop interventions, train agency staff, and use relevant behavioral data to monitor client performance and make treatment decisions * Work in various settings including individual’s homes, day programs, group homes * Provide support, guidance, direction, and supervision to direct support professionals * Interface with guardians and/or administrators and other agency staff to coordinate schedules and services * Generate progress reports * Submit assessment, quarterly, semi-annual, and annual IPP reports in a timely manner (defined individually by agency, regional center, and case) to the Clinical Director * Submit assigned tasks on time * Engage in proactive communication * Update clinical staff and caregivers on client progress at least monthly * Record and graph data consistently * Conduct functional assessments under the supervision of the Clinical Director * Develop, implement and monitor Behavior Support Plans * Assess and train direct support staff (e.g., collecting reliability data on programs and assessments, monitor treatment integrity) * Make efficient, sound, and ethical clinical judgments and recommendations * Establish a good rapport with clients, co-workers and other professionals and paraprofessionals * Conduct staff training using Behavior Skills Training (BST) * Provide consistent treatment per recommended hours to all clients on a monthly basis * Practice in accordance with applicable laws and regulations as a mandated reporter, Pyles and Associates company policies, as well as the BACB ethical guidelines * Performs other duties as assigned reasonably within the scope of a Master’s Level Program Manager
